Omeedy

TomTom

Travel
Paid 21,100 Visits
Navigation technology.

About TomTom

TomTom provides maps and traffic data for drivers and businesses.

Reviews (0)

No reviews yet. Be the first!

You might also like

Freemium
Hocoos
Coding
Free
LinkCheck2
Writing & Web SEO
Paid
MockupMaster
Image & Design
Freemium
Humata AI
Productivity